Video hosting websites frequently show informational videos that present or review specific products on the web. Oftentimes once can search for a review for a specific product they are interested in and check for videos and an entire list of websites appears. On top of the list YouTube and DailyMotion have a wide selection of such videos, followed closely by Vzaar, Ecommerceplayer, Motionbox, I2iAuction and many more.

Online auctions have made great use of these websites that host videos to post links on the webpage of a specific item in order to redirect potential buyers to a video showing off the product. An auction video is sometimes the best way to show what an item looks like or what it does. It is a true marketing technique that has helped the world of online auctioning.

Auction videos and video hosting websites have a close relationship today as our bandwidth allows us to download great amounts of information for our viewing delight. Why buy an item with one picture when we can find out more about that item from a video?

Auctioning websites allow videos on auction items that can be either linked to videos hosted on other websites or they can embed them directly on their pages. The link between goods put up for sale and videos have increased in importance in the last few years and videos have become an integral part of some auctioning websites. Video hosting sites have been completely integrated into the whole process of bidding.
